It is 11. However, the machine requires $80 coin-in for one base reward credit. Therefore, you would have to play 2,000 hands at the one credit level to earn 25 points. The return is 98.95% for one credit, so the expected loss is $21. If you can't afford to play $5/hand, I wouldn't bother with it. It's be easier to earn your points playing a table game like Spanish 21, baccarat, or craps for 1-1.5 hours (how I earned my points).

The Diamond Lounge in Metropolis is also surprisingly nice with very good dinner service. The DL in Elizabeth is mediocre -- try the restaurants or buffet instead. St. Louis DL has a nice buffet.

Although not the main point of the post and reply, when you play FP Pick'em at less than 5 coin, it is not just the Royal that is shorted, but also the straight flush as well as fours of a kind.

Royal 5 Coin = 6,000 or 1,200 per coin; 1 Coin pays 1,000 (short pay of 200 per coin).

Straight Flush 5 coin = 1,199 or 240+- per coin; 1 Coin pays 200 (short pay of 40 per coin).

4 of a Kind 5 coin = 600 or 120 per coin; 1 coin pays 100 (short pay of 20 per coin).

I can under certain circumstances understand playing only one coin, but at an eastern US Casino, it used to amaze me that quite a few regular players (that were otherwise bright people) often used to play 3 and even 4 coin rather than 5 at this game with short pay in three categories when they played less than 5 coin.
